Output 66fbf97b2c8607b71d23fcadc31f42656bdcaa50698e9b38b50ece0855cb6a38:1

value
1515031
script pubkey
OP_0 OP_PUSHBYTES_20 e0837bb836c85c30d827b97065c7f2870c5cfaf7
address
bc1quzphhwpkepwrpkp8h9cxt3ljsux9e7hhq2tm79
transaction
66fbf97b2c8607b71d23fcadc31f42656bdcaa50698e9b38b50ece0855cb6a38
spent
true